The body of a fisherman who disappeared on the Caspian Sea has been found
Baku/10.06.21/Turan: The body of a fisherman who went missing two days ago has been found on the Caspian coast. He put to the sea on June 8 in his motor boat and never returned.
On June 9, his overturned boat was spotted at sea. Note that the search for Khamis Khalilov, a 28-year-old resident of the village of Khydyrly, Salyan district,was conducted by divers of the state Service for Rescue in the waters of the Ministry of Emergency Situations.
Today, the body of a fisherman was found in the reeds on the beach, according to Turan.
According to the preliminary version, the cause of death was that the fisherman was in the water when another motor boat passed over him to cause him severe head injuries. The fact is under investigation.—06D-
